What is a PURCHASING MANAGER?
A purchasing manager is responsible for coordinating and managing all aspects of a company's purchasing activities. This includes sourcing and procuring goods and services needed for a company's operations, negotiating contracts and pricing with suppliers, and ensuring that purchases are made in a timely and cost-effective manner.
Purchasing managers play a crucial role in helping a company achieve its financial goals by minimizing costs, maximizing value, and maintaining inventory levels to meet demand. They are responsible for developing and implementing procurement strategies, analyzing market trends, and identifying potential suppliers who can provide high-quality products at competitive prices.
In addition to strategic planning and supplier management, purchasing managers also oversee the purchasing process, from requisition to delivery. They collaborate with various departments within an organization, such as production, finance, and marketing, to understand their needs and make informed purchasing decisions. They are also responsible for maintaining accurate records, tracking expenditures, and managing budgets.
To excel in this role, purchasing managers need strong analytical and negotiation skills, as well as the ability to build and maintain relationships with suppliers.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and strong organizational skills are also important qualities for success in this career.
Most purchasing managers have a bachelor's degree in business, supply chain management, or a related field. Some employers may prefer candidates with a master's degree or professional certification, such as Certified Professional in Supply Management (CPSM) or Certified Purchasing Manager (CPM).
The average salary for a purchasing manager varies depending on the industry and location, but the median annual wage in the United States is around $110,000. The demand for purchasing managers is expected to grow at a steady pace, driven by the need for efficient supply chain management and strategic procurement in organizations.
